Classic FPV VTX: Operation , Reach, and Setup

Analog picture transmitters (VTX) remain a common option for many FPV flyers , offering a raw feeling and generally simple configuration . Performance is typically assessed by factors such as power and channel consistency , directly impacting the transmission quality . Range can fluctuate considerably based on antenna sort, power levels, and environmental circumstances ; expect ranges from a some hundred meters to beyond a 1000 meters, but this is very vulnerable to obstruction. Setup generally necessitates binding the VTX to your controller and setting the output level, ensuring agreement with your picture recipient .

  • Evaluate antenna alignment for best functionality.
  • Test your signal intensity before flying .
  • Always ensure compliance with local guidelines regarding output limits.

Troubleshooting Frequent Issues with Your Analog Video VTX

Experiencing troubles with your standard visual transmitter ? Quite a few common issues can occur. Initially , check your electrical supply – a low connection can lead to broadcast failure. Next , inspect the aerial for damage ; a broken antenna drastically diminishes range . Furthermore , make sure your visual wire isn't damaged , as this can cause noise . Finally , refer your VTX 's manual for particular troubleshooting guidance.
